Avdija's 41-Point Masterclass

Deni Avdija led the Portland Trail Blazers to a stunning 114-110 victory over the Phoenix Suns.

Avdija scored 41 points, shot 15-of-22 from the field, and added 12 assists and seven rebounds.

He capped the game with a go-ahead three-point play with 16.1 seconds left.

The Blazers rallied from an 11-point fourth-quarter deficit.

Jrue Holiday scored 21 points and Jerami Grant returned from injury to add 16.

The Suns were led by Jalen Green's 35 points and Devin Booker's 22.

Playoff Implications

The Blazers' win secures the No. 7 seed and a first-round matchup against the Spurs.

The Suns will have to play a win-or-go-home game against the Clippers or Warriors.

The Suns entered the play-in as the seventh seed at 45-37.

The Blazers had finished the regular season 28th in three-point shooting at 34.3%.

Portland's late-season surge saw them win 10 of 14 games.

Injury and Rotation Notes

The Suns were without Grayson Allen, who was downgraded to out.

Jerami Grant returned for the Blazers after missing eight games.

Portland started Scoot Henderson, Jrue Holiday, Toumani Camara, Donovan Clingan, and Avdija.

The Suns started Booker, Green, Goodwin, Brooks, and Williams.

The Blazers' center tandem of Clingan and Robert Williams was highlighted as a key matchup factor.

Portland is the sixth-best rebounding team at 46.0 per game.

The game was played before a sellout crowd of 17,071 at the Mortgage Matchup Center.

It was streamed exclusively on Amazon Prime Video.

The Blazers will face the Spurs in San Antonio with Game 1 set for April 19.

The Suns will host the winner of the Clippers-Warriors game on April 17.

The Blazers' victory ended a five-year playoff drought.
